RS3 EOC 2 New Combat Update: Ability Books Rework
RuneScape 3 is constantly evolving, and the EOC 2 combat update is no exception. While the update introduces high-level changes like the level 120 cap and revamped skillcapes, one of the most significant—but often overlooked—changes is the Ability Books Rework. At first glance, it may seem like a minor interface improvement, but it fundamentally changes how players, especially newcomers, interact with abilities. This rework makes combat more intuitive, streamlines progression, and allows players to focus on mastering their chosen combat style without being overwhelmed.
In the old system, the ability book could be intimidating for new players. Abilities were displayed randomly, forcing players to experiment and memorize which ability did what. This randomness slowed down learning and often led to inefficient combat, especially during high-stakes boss fights or PvP encounters. With the rework, Jagex has organized abilities into clear categories, giving players a logical framework for understanding their options.
The new categories are:
1.Basic Ability: These abilities generate 9% adrenaline. They are straightforward and cost-effective, designed to form the backbone of combat rotations. Players can reliably use these to build adrenaline for more powerful attacks.
2.Enhanced Ability: More powerful than basic abilities, these may generate no adrenaline or even consume some. They are meant to be used strategically, offering higher damage or utility at the cost of adrenaline management.
3.Ultimate Ability: The pinnacle of your combat arsenal. Ultimate abilities are high-cost, high-impact skills that can dramatically turn the tide of a fight. Their placement in the ability book ensures players know exactly when to unleash them.
4.Utility Ability: These abilities do not fit the traditional damage-dealing model. For example, Surge increases mobility, allowing for strategic repositioning during battles. By separating utility abilities into their own section, players can easily locate and leverage them during critical moments.
New Ability Unlock System
One of the most player-friendly changes is how new abilities are introduced. Previously, unlocking a new ability required players to discover its function through trial and error, which could be confusing and sometimes frustrating. Now, whenever a player unlocks an ability, a pop-up appears with a clear description of its function and recommended use.
This pop-up not only explains the ability's mechanics but also provides tactical advice on when to use it. For example, a newly unlocked Enhanced ability might suggest using it at a high-adrenaline threshold or against specific boss mechanics. This ensures that players can implement abilities effectively from the moment they are unlocked, reducing confusion and improving combat efficiency.
